NOUN

Metropole/metʁoˈpoːlə/metropolis; major city; urban center

Metropole is a German noun that means metropolis, major city, or urban center. It is pronounced /metʁoˈpoːlə/. As a noun it takes the article "die", with the plural form "Metropolen".

Definitions

1.large, important city, often a center of culture, economy, or politics(city, geography)

a.major city with significant influence or population

Berlin ist eine bedeutende europäische Metropole.Berlin is a major European metropolis.

b.center of cultural, economic, or political activity

Paris gilt als Metropole der Modewelt.Paris is considered the metropolis of the fashion world.

Declension

Genderfeminine

SingularPlural
Nominativedie Metropoledie Metropolen
Genitiveder Metropoleder Metropolen
Dativeder Metropoleden Metropolen
Accusativedie Metropoledie Metropolen
